Materials science has evolved from a purely empirical discipline into a quantitative and computational field. Complex materials frequently exhibit heterogeneity across multiple spatial and temporal scales. Classical Euclidean geometry is often insufficient to characterize such irregular structures. Multifractal analysis provides a rigorous mathematical framework for describing scale-dependent complexity and disorder in materials systems .This book presents theoretical foundations, computational methodologies, and applications of multifractal analysis in materials science.
